أخطاء شهادة SSL ليست مشهداً جميلاً. يمكن أن تظهر من العدم وتخيف زوارك. حتى مشرفي المواقع المتمرسين قد يتدافعون للبحث عن إصلاحات سريعة لإعادة تشغيل الموقع الإلكتروني.
أحد أخطاء SSL الأكثر شيوعًا هو خطأ ERR_SSL_VERSION_OR_OR_CIPHER_MISMATCH.
قد تواجه أيضًا أشكالًا مختلفة من هذا الخطأ:
- الخطأ 113 (net::err_ssl_ssl_version_version_ orcipher_mismatch): خطأ غير معروف
- لا يدعم العميل والخادم إصدار بروتوكول SSL مشترك أو مجموعة تشفير مشتركة
ما الذي يسبب ERR_SSL_VERSION_OR_O_CIPHER_MISMATCH في Chrome؟
يحدث ذلك عندما يتعذر على المتصفح إنشاء اتصال آمن مع خادم الويب.
أحد الأسباب الرئيسية لهذا الخطأ هو عدم تطابق اسم الشهادة. ومع ذلك، قد تكمن المشكلة في مكان آخر. لهذا السبب يجب أن تفحص شهادة SSL الخاصة بك باستخدام أداة احترافية لتشخيص الخلل الدقيق.
لحسن الحظ، يقدم القائمون على مختبرات Qualys SSL Labs خدمة مجانية عبر الإنترنت تقوم بإجراء تحليل عميق لتهيئة SSL لديك وتحدد المشكلة.
كيفية إصلاح ERR_SSL_VERSL_VERSION_OR_CIPHER_MISMATCH
ستجد أدناه بعض الأسباب المحتملة التي تؤدي إلى حدوث هذا الخطأ بالتحديد:
1. عدم تطابق اسم الشهادة
أول شيء يجب عليك التحقق منه هو عدم تطابق اسم الشهادة. يظهر في الحالات التالية:
- لا يستخدم الموقع الإلكتروني SSL ولكنه يشارك عنوان IP مع بعض المواقع الأخرى التي تستخدمه.
- لم يعد الموقع الإلكتروني موجودًا، ولكن عنوان IP يشير إلى موقع جديد أو موجود بنطاق مختلف وشهادة SSL
- يستخدم الموقع شبكة توصيل محتوى (CDN) لا تدعم SSL.
- الاسم المستعار لاسم النطاق هو لموقع إلكتروني اسمه مختلف، ولكن لم يتم تضمين الاسم المستعار في الشهادة.
2. إصدار TLS القديم لا يزال قيد الاستخدام
للحصول على أفضل أمان وأداء ل SSL، يجب عليك استخدام بروتوكولي TLS 1.2 أو TLS 1.3. تعمل معظم المواقع على الإصدار TLS 1.2، وهو الإصدار الموجود منذ أكثر من عقد من الزمان. ولكن مع تزايد دعم TLS 1.3، يمكنك أيضًا الترحيل إلى أحدث إصدار.
لقد كتبنا نظرة عامة سريعة على TLS 1.3، مع خطوات حول كيفية تمكينه على خادمك.
3. مجموعة شفرات RC4 المهملة
وفقًا لوثائق كروم، فإن أحد الأسباب المحتملة ل ERR_SSL_VERSL_VERSION_OR_OR_CIPHER_MISMATCH هو مجموعة تشفير RC4 التي تم إهمالها الآن. تمت إزالته في الإصدار 48 من Chrome، ولكن قد يستمر ظهوره في أنظمة المؤسسات الكبيرة، والتي تستغرق ترقية نظامها وقتًا أطول.
يجب عليك التحقق من تهيئة الخادم الخاص بك والتأكد من تمكينه بمجموعة تشفير مختلفة.
4. قائمة SSL على جهاز الكمبيوتر الخاص بك
في بعض الأحيان، قد تواجه هذا الخطأ على جهازك فقط، بينما يعمل الموقع بشكل جيد على أجهزة الكمبيوتر الأخرى. إذا كانت هذه هي المشكلة، ابدأ بمسح حالة SSL في Chrome. تقوم قائمة SSL بتخزين ذاكرة تخزين مؤقت لشهادات SSL، ويمكنك تفريغها تمامًا كما تمسح ذاكرة التخزين المؤقت للمتصفح.
- انقر على أيقونة إعدادات جوجل كروم، ثم انقر على الإعدادات.
- انقر فوق إظهار الإعدادات المتقدمة.
- ضمن الشبكة، انقر فوق تغيير إعدادات الوكيل. سيظهر مربع الحوار خصائص الإنترنت.
- انقر فوق علامة التبويب المحتوى.
- انقر فوق مسح حالة SSL، ثم انقر فوق موافق.
- أعد تشغيل كروم.
5. بروتوكول كويك في كروم
QUIC هو بروتوكول جديد من Google يجعل الويب أسرع وأكثر كفاءة. ولسوء الحظ، قد يتسبب أحيانًا في حدوث أخطاء غير متوقعة، بما في ذلك الخطأ ERR_SSL_VERSION_OR_OR_CIPHER_MISMATCH.
للتأكد من أن كويك ليس هو المشكلة، حاول تعطيله لفترة من الوقت وشاهد ما سيحدث.
- اكتب chrome://flags#enable-quic في شريط عنوان متصفح كروم واضغط على Enter.
- تحت خيار بروتوكول QUIC التجريبي التجريبي، قم بتغييره من افتراضي إلى معطل.
- أعد تشغيل كروم.
إذا كنت لا تزال ترى الخطأ، فإننا نوصيك بإعادة تمكين QUIC، حيث أن هناك شيئًا آخر يسبب المشكلة.
6. مضاد الفيروسات الخاص بك
إذا قمت بالتحقق من كل خطوة من الخطوات المذكورة أعلاه واستمر الخطأ ERR_SSL_VERSION_OR_OR_CIPHER_MISMATCH، فقم بتعطيل برنامج مكافحة الفيروسات. تحظر بعض برامج مكافحة الفيروسات تحميل بعض مواقع الويب وقد ترى خطأ SSL نتيجة لذلك.
إذا وجدت أي معلومات غير دقيقة أو كانت لديك تفاصيل تود إضافتها إلى هذا البرنامج التعليمي الخاص بـ SSL، يُرجى إرسال ملاحظاتك إلينا على [email protected]. ستكون مساهمتك محل تقدير كبير! شكراً لك.
ناقلات الأعمال التي أنشأها بيكيسوبيرستار – www.freepik.com
وفِّر 10% على شهادات SSL عند الطلب اليوم!
إصدار سريع، وتشفير قوي، وثقة في المتصفح بنسبة 99.99%، ودعم مخصص، وضمان استرداد المال خلال 25 يومًا. رمز القسيمة: SAVE10